**Epiphany: The Three Kings' Journey**

Epiphany, also known as Three Kings' Day, is celebrated on January 6th in many Christian countries. It commemorates the visit of the three wise men, or magi, to the baby Jesus. This day is often marked by the exchange of gifts, the wearing of crowns, and the baking of King Cake. The following illustration captures the spirit of this festive occasion.

**Lantern Festival: Light and Hope**

The Lantern Festival, also known as Yuanxiao, is held on the 15th day of the first lunar month, which usually falls in January or February. It marks the end of the Chinese New Year celebrations. The festival is characterized by the lighting of lanterns, which symbolize light and hope. The following illustration shows a beautiful scene of lanterns illuminating the night sky.
